It was one of Rafas true genius strokes to see his potential, and turn him into a Dm from his original role.

In the early days, just like Can probably will, Lucas took a couple of seasons to adapt into the role, and he gave away a lot of clumsy free kicks, and he also took a lot of flack from the fans during that education. I thought he was basically rubbish for most of his first season to be honest.

Now that he can do the role really well, and once the injuries are well behind him, he will only get better. It makes no sense to let him go, none at all- he is one of the best and most underrated DMs in the league.

I hope and pray that BR has the nous to make Lucas the first name on that teamsheet every single week, and for me it is one of the clearest signs of BRs lack of vision that he cannot see how much Lucas influences the game, gets a strong tackle in, takes the pressure off the side, and allows the team some breathing space to develop our own game.

He doesn't score goals or play the 35 yard hollywood balls (that most times come to nothing anyway), but he closes players down very quickly, breaks up or slows down opposition moves, and he always seems to keep hold of the ball under a challenge, and usually finds a ten yard forward pass to give us an outlet and get us moving forwards again.

He doesn't only do the defensive role- he gets the ball moving again, and often very quickly with one touch.
Is he the player he was 2/3 years ago before the big injuries? Maybe not quite, but if he stays free of injury he will get better and stronger, and he still has 2 or 3 years of top performances left in him.
I would let any other player in that squad go before Lucas- barring maybe Coutinho.
A top DM seems to be almost as difficult to find as a top striker these days. We have one in the squad, so why on earth would we let him go?
